3. Lose yourself in the exotic, tropical Butterfly Farm in Noord

Walk hand in hand with your partner through a verdant tropical rain forest amidst fragrant flowers, lush trees, gurgling waterfalls, and serene ponds while colorful butterflies fly all around you. Visiting Aruba’s famous Butterfly Farm is like being in your own romantic Disney world - a must-visit destination if you are planning a holiday on the island. Learn about the lifecycles of butterflies, see spectacular species from the world over and pick up a few butterfly-related souvenirs to remember your visit to this natural paradise. Plan an early morning visit, and you might even ger to see a butterfly emerging from the pupa! This unique Aruba activity for couples will create lasting memories, for sure.
The Butterfly Farm
Address: J.E. Irausquin Blvd, Noord, Aruba
Website: The Butterfly Farm
Opening hours: 8:30am - 4:30pm (daily)
Price: 15 USD per person

6. Soak in the beautiful coastal views of Boca Prins in Santa Cruz
An Aruba vacation for couples will not be complete without a visit to this majestic place. Located in Aruba’s pristine Arikok National Park, Boca Prins Beach offers spectacular ocean vistas, huge sand dunes, and dramatic rocky shores. Beautiful wooden steps lead you down to the hidden beach. Hauntingly romantic, this part of the coastline offers the most romantic trails for couples to explore in seclusion while enjoying the cool ocean breeze. There is a charming Boca Prins Restaurant where you can rest for a while and have a bite while enjoying the iconic views.
Boca Prins
Address: Boca Prins Beach, Arikok National Park, Santa Cruz, Aruba
Website: Boca Prins Beach
Opening hours: 24 hours (daily)
Price: Free

Papiamento is a 126-year-old Aruban house converted into a fine dining restaurant where you can woo your partner with a charming dinner in a heritage setting. The house boasts of antique furniture, gorgeous European artifacts, dating back to the early 1800s, and a romantic tropical garden with pool. Prepared using fresh local spices, vegetables, and herbs, the food here is delicious and creatively plated using cactus, okra, and even papaya!
Papiamento Restaurant
Address: Washington 61, Noord, Aruba
Website: Papiamento Restaurant
Opening hours: Mon - Sat: 6pm - 9:30pm (closed on Sun)
10. Light a candle at the quaint Alto Vista Chapel in Noord

Originally built by Domingo Silvestre in 1750, the present Alto Vista Chapel was rebuilt in 1952. You’ll find a charming church, painting an unusual bright yellow on the outside. The interiors have an altar statue of the Virgin Mary and are enshrined with beautiful crosses including an ancient Spanish one that is said to be among the oldest European art pieces in the Dutch Caribbean. There are stone pews outside, to add to the wooden ones inside the small and peaceful church.
Alto Vista Chapel
Address: Noord, Aruba
Opening hours: 5:30am - 7pm (daily)

12. Nourish your body and soul at Spa Del Sol in Oranjestad

A beachside sanctuary with Caribbean-Balinese vibes, this spa is an ideal place to pamper your loved one with a romantic couples massage. Decorated with elegant teak wood furnishings, the bright spa offers thatched cabanas with gorgeous turquoise ocean vistas, where you can enjoy a variety of individualized treatments. Choose from shiatsu massage, hot stone, body scrubs, and even honeymoon packages. Let all your aches, worries, and stress melt away in this peaceful open-air retreat.
Spa Del Sol
Address: J.E. Irausquin Blvd 55, Eagle Beach, Oranjestad, Aruba
Website: Spa Del Sol
Opening hours: Mon - Sat: 9am - 6pm; Sun: 10am - 2pm
Price: From 80 USD
